Florida and Auburn lag way behind in "Big 6" team salaries
For Napier, Florida went really big on the support staff which isn’t included in these numbers. They probably have twice as many as they had under Mullen. I think the AD wanted a big support staff and that’s why they went G5 coach hunting.
The assistant pool in Napier’s contract was to be 7.5 million. That was right behind 7.8 for Alabama and in front of 7.2 for Georgia at the time. The fact USA Today calls it 6.5 now is likely indicative that Napier shifted even more to the support staff.
Napier has done nothing to warrant a renewal or new terms on his contract, that’s why Florida is at 2021 level spending while salaries have spiked again.
